    Date of transaction 9/20/21 Went into the store to replace a broken phone. Did not realize the store was no longer a Verizon Corporate Store due to lack of signage. We were mislead into purchasing 3 phones that we were told were opened because they had been shown to customers and had to be labeled as such due to protocols. We asked several times and were assured they were brand new phones and were told they have to open the boxes to show to customers do this several time per day. Further review of the receipt shows they are used phones and possibly old inventory (box stamped ******). In addition we told the sales rep NOT to change our calling plan which upon further review of our account has been downgraded for the 3 lines. He The sales rep also assured us he would contact us the next day to provide proof (screen shots) that the phones had been wiped clean. An employee at a sister store was helpful in setting up the return of our old phones but was possibly reprimanded by MGMT.

    As a business teacher for 36 years, I teach my students to advocate for themselves in an honest way to maintain credibility. In this case, my credibility is being questioned by a salesperson at the Verizon Authorized Cellular Sales retailer in the Mall of NH. I stopped by this store for a quote on one new phone. The salesman looked at my account and said it would be a better deal to upgrade all four of our phones. He circled the new monthly payment ($251.00) stating that I would save $10 per month. After we agreed to upgrade I noticed that my new payment ($262.35) was actually MORE than my previous bill ($261.77). When I went back to speak to the salesman, he looked over the account and admitted he made a mistake and forgot to add tax when he quoted me. He said he could not honor his original quote, but would refund the $45 per line ($180 total) fee that this store charges for activation. It wasn’t much, but at least it was something. After a month I contacted this salesman again because I had not yet received this refund. He replied that I misled HIM, and that “I would absolutely not be getting any credits.” So much for customer service! I asked for the name and number of his manager, and he told me he would not provide me with a number, instead saying that he would pass along my info. That was over a week ago and I have not been contacted yet. So either he didn’t tell his manager, or the manager didn’t feel it was important enough to follow through. Either way, their attention to this matter is unacceptable! Bottom line, my new bill is NOT $10 cheaper than my old one as promised (it is actually .58 more). The salesman admitted he made a mistake and said he would refund $45 per line for HIS mistake that he is now not honoring. How can you trust a business that treats its customers in that manner? There are many options for cellular service, and I hope in reading this review that others will learn from my experience to shop elsewhere. I know I will.
